Balancing Automation with Human Expertise

While artificial intelligence can provide valuable insights, it cannot fully replace human judgment. Successful hiring often involves evaluating qualities that are difficult to measure through algorithms alone.

Communication skills, leadership potential, emotional intelligence, and cultural alignment remain important considerations in recruitment decisions. Human recruiters bring context, experience, and interpersonal understanding that technology cannot replicate.

Organizations that excel in AI Hiring and Trust in Candidate Screening use AI as a support tool rather than a replacement for recruiters. Automated systems handle data-intensive tasks while hiring professionals focus on relationship-building and final evaluations.

This collaborative approach creates a more balanced and effective recruitment strategy.

Reducing Bias Through Responsible AI

Bias has long been a challenge in recruitment. Human decision-making can be influenced by unconscious assumptions that affect hiring outcomes. Artificial intelligence has the potential to reduce some forms of bias by focusing on measurable qualifications and skills.

However, responsible implementation is essential. AI systems learn from historical data, and biased datasets can produce biased recommendations if not properly managed.

Organizations committed to AI Hiring and Trust in Candidate Screening regularly review their algorithms, audit outcomes, and update systems to ensure fairness. Ethical oversight plays a critical role in maintaining equitable recruitment practices.

Continuous monitoring helps organizations identify potential issues and make improvements that support diversity and inclusion goals.
